I'm trying to figure out the best way to automatically discount the price of my product based on the quantity ordered. For example, 1 for $16, 2 for $30, etc. I originally set this up as a pricing variant on my product. However, I see two issues with this: 1) I do not think it will automatically update my inventory when a customer orders. 2) In the checkout page, there are two different areas that say "quantity." One of them is a dropdown menu. When a customer adjusts the quantity on the dropdown menu, this discounted price structure doesn't apply. 3) In the picture of the shopping cart below, the customer has adjusted quantity to 4. Then, if they want to adjust the quantity from the shopping cart, they can't just add a single item. Instead, when they adjust the quantity to 2, it adds 8 more (4 x 2), instead of 4 + 1. Ah! Not sure if this make sense, but hopefully in the picture you can see the issue. I understand that automatic discounts can be applied on the commerce advance plan. However, I'm wondering: Is there a better way to set up this price structure automatically, other than using price variants? If I need to use the price variant, how can the discount be applied when a customer adjusts the quantity in their cart? Any guidance, insight, or solutions is much appreciated! Cheers! Meredith
